Transaction 3bd91c950101e65620d9d40f707a8714f21571f6521e2f5f1cd9b41af7342f72
1 Input
2 Outputs
- 3bd91c950101e65620d9d40f707a8714f21571f6521e2f5f1cd9b41af7342f72:0
- 3bd91c950101e65620d9d40f707a8714f21571f6521e2f5f1cd9b41af7342f72:1
value 4000000
address 1Aw6Vp1uoRtriDXmn7ngyphbWHNxo7p4pz
value 303631065
address 3F62FWV8NyavjWizsFNeK6v8DbCZqa3AMU